Job Description : Position Title: Landscape Crew Member
Reports to: Operations Manager, Crew Leader
Position Overview: Landscape installation and renovation, irrigation and hardscape installation, proper upkeep of established landscaping, etc. for Residential, Commercial and Homeowner Associations.
Responsibilities include, but are not limited to:

Installation of hardscape and softscape material according to design specifications.
Help with landscape installation of hardscape designs including patios, brick pavers, stairs, retaining walls, outdoor kitchens, fire pits etc.
Help with landscape installation of plants, edging and mulch, lawns, irrigation and drainage
Tree and shrub planting, pruning, monitoring and maintenance.
Installation and maintenance of annual and perennial beds and planters.
Installation of irrigation systems and various water features.
Installation of drainage systems and retaining walls.
Installation of fabric, sod, decorative rock, mulch, etc.
Operate light and heavy equipment, automotive equipment, power tools and hand tools.
Keep work vehicles and equipment clean and organized.
Perform tasks such as proper planting, mulching, lighting installation, and paver installation, irrigation installation, etc.
Loading/unloading of trucks, trailers, and equipment
Operate a variety of mechanical equipment (i.e. mini excavators, skid steers, sod cutters, etc.)
Work with other crew members as a team
Perform such other activities as may be temporarily or permanently assigned.

Requirements:

Must have reliable transportation to and from work.
Must be legally able to be employed in Texas
Possess and maintain a valid US Driver License, if in a driving position.
Ability to lift 50lbs or more on a daily basis.
Ability to interact professionally with all customers, employees and those from external organizations.
Ready to work, on time, dressed to work every day
Have a positive attitude and works well within a team environment

Work Environment: This position requires physical abilities such as strength, manual dexterity, and must be able to perform all required functions of this position. While performing the duties of this job, the Landscape Crew Member is regularly required to stand, walk, bend, lift, crouch, reach, stoop, crawl or kneel. The position is regularly exposed to outdoor environmental conditions including extreme hot and cold conditions. Additional working conditions may include inadequate lighting, restricted movement and
dirty/wet worksites.
This position may be required to work on weekends and holidays. Due to the seasonal nature of work, some peak load situations may arise.
Working Relationships: The Landscape Crew Member will work closely with Crew Leaders, Operations Manager, Owners, other Landscape Crew Members, Office Manager, Irrigation Technicians, and Lawn Care Technicians. At all times, the Landscape Crew
Member is a representative of Peola Outdoor Living & Landscape LLC. and will conduct him/herself in an appropriate manner.
